This commit is contained in:
bniwredyc 2023-05-14 17:48:37 +02:00
parent d4aaa55cee
commit 0bebe82528

View File

@ -11,18 +11,21 @@ jobs:
steps:
- name: Checkout source repository
uses: actions/checkout@v2
uses: actions/checkout@v3
- uses: webfactory/ssh-agent@v0.8.0
with:
ssh-private-key: ${{ secrets.SSH_PRIVATE_KEY }}
- name: Push to dokku
env:
HOST_KEY: ${{ secrets.HOST_KEY }}
SSH_PRIVATE_KEY: ${{ secrets.SSH_PRIVATE_KEY }}
run: |
mkdir ~/.ssh
# mkdir ~/.ssh
echo $HOST_KEY > ~/.ssh/known_hosts
echo $SSH_PRIVATE_KEY > ~/.ssh/id_rsa
openssl rsa -in ~/.ssh/id_rsa -check
chmod 600 ~/.ssh/id_rsa
# echo $SSH_PRIVATE_KEY > ~/.ssh/id_rsa
# openssl rsa -in ~/.ssh/id_rsa -check
# chmod 600 ~/.ssh/id_rsa
git config --global core.sshCommand "ssh -vvv"
git remote add dokku dokku@v2.discours.io:discoursio-api
git push dokku HEAD:main